Virtual reality is becoming more prominent than ever. The improved performance of mobile devices, along with the growing interest in more immersive user experiences, have allowed virtual reality to gain solid standing in this regard: nowadays, a smartphone and a pair of VR goggles are all that is needed for a full VR experience. The uses of VR systems extend beyond home entertainment: in particular, we are tackling the possibility that VR can be used by therapists to aid patients suffering from neuro- developmental disorders (NDD) [1,2]. To that, an adaptive system that can change different aspects of the VR environment, using machine learning techniques, can go a long way in increasing the efficiency of NDD treatments.
